Your Personal Net Worth Calculation: The Ultimate SEO Guide

Understanding your personal net worth calculation clarifies your true financial position beyond monthly cash flow. This snapshot of assets minus liabilities helps you track progress, set realistic goals, and make confident money decisions.

Use the structured overview below to align definitions, data sources, and calculation frequency so you always start from a consistent reference point.

Definition Key Components Data Sources Suggested Frequency
Net Worth Total assets minus total liabilities Bank statements, investment accounts, loan documents Monthly or quarterly
Liquid Net Worth Cash and easily sellable assets minus immediate liabilities Checking, savings, brokerage positions Monthly
Gross Assets All items of value before debts Home valuation, retirement balances, business equity Quarterly
Net Worth Trend Direction and rate of change over time Historical snapshots, spreadsheet or tool records Track with each full calculation

How to Calculate Personal Net Worth Step by Step

Start by listing every account balance, investment position, and tangible asset at current market value. Then list all loan balances, credit card amounts, and outstanding payment obligations to arrive at a reliable personal net worth calculation.

Separate short term and long term items so your net worth calculation reflects both immediate liquidity and enduring wealth building. Consistent valuation methods prevent noise and make period over period changes meaningful.

Include All Asset Types for a Complete Picture

Cash and Liquid Investments

Include checking, savings, money market funds, and easily redeemable brokerage positions at current value. These components form the base layer of your overall net worth calculation and support emergency planning.

Retirement and Long Term Accounts

Add 401k, IRA, pension values, and other tax advantaged balances, using most recent statements. Remember that future contributions and growth projections differ from the current snapshot used in your net worth calculation.

Real Estate and Tangible Assets

Value your primary home, rental properties, and other real estate using recent appraisals or credible market comparables. Include vehicles, jewelry, and collectibles only if they have verifiable market values that meaningfully affect your net worth calculation.

Understanding Liabilities and Net Debt Impact

Secured Debt Categories

Mortgages, car loans, and secured lines of credit reduce your true net worth and should be recorded with current outstanding balances. Interest rates and payment schedules matter less for the calculation than the present owed principal.

Unsecured Obligations

Credit cards, personal loans, and medical bills are subtracted in full at current balance. Even if you pay in full each month, report the statement balance at the snapshot date for consistency in your net worth calculation.

Key Takeaways for Ongoing Financial Clarity

  • Calculate assets at current market value and liabilities at current owed amounts.
  • Separate liquid and long term components to understand immediate financial flexibility.
  • Update data from reliable sources on a regular schedule for accurate tracking.
  • Review trend lines rather than single point snapshots to gauge real progress.
  • Maintain consistent definitions and valuation rules to ensure period over period comparability.

FAQ

Reader questions

How often should I recalculate my personal net worth?

Recalculate at least monthly to capture cash flow effects and quarterly to include investment and market changes, adjusting for major life events as they occur.

Should I include future income in my net worth calculation?

No, include only realized balances and current market values; future earnings are not assets until they are received and converted into cash or investments.

What if I own a business with uncertain value? Use conservative, professionally supported valuations or recent funding rounds, and disclose assumptions so your net worth calculation remains transparent and comparable over time. How do I value my primary home for personal net worth purposes?

Use recent comparable sales, a licensed appraisal, or a reputable index estimate, and apply the same methodology each period to keep trends consistent and meaningful.
